Business Context and Reporting Period
Vertical Aerospace Ltd. filed a Form 6-K on January 23, 2025, reporting a material corporate event. The filing details the execution of an underwriting agreement for a public offering of securities in the United States.
Key Financial Metrics
This filing does not report operational financial metrics such as rev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, or existing debt levels. The primary financial data point disclosed is the capital raise structure:
- Offering Size: $90 million in aggregate gross proceeds.
- Security Type: Units consisting of one ordinary share, one-half of one Tranche A warrant, and one-half of one Tranche B warrant.
- Public Offering Price: $6.00 per Unit.
- Warrant Terms: Tranche A warrants have an exercise price of $6.00 per share; Tranche B warrants have an exercise price of $7.50 per share.
